			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><strong>First Derivatives acquires US-based Reference Data Management Solutions</strong></p>
<p>Company Deal extends company’s footprint in capital markets to financial data management, reference data and security master space</p>
<p>First Derivatives plc (AIM: FDP.L, IEX: GYQ.I), a leading provider of software and consulting services to global investment banks and hedge funds this morning announced the acquisition of Reference Data Factory (“RDF”), a New York-based technology company specialising in financial data management systems, in a deal worth approximately $10m US dollars.</p>
<p>Founded in 1996, First Derivatives currently employs 360 people worldwide and boasts many of the world’s top financial institutions as clients. The company has developed its own range of software – Delta &#8211; which is in use in many of the top tier investment banks and hedge funds. The Delta suite of products includes algorithmic/program trading solutions, market data solutions, risk management applications and market data management software. First Derivatives also provides consulting services to clients, across the globe with operational centres in Europe (London and Stockholm), Amercias (New York, Chicago and Toronto) and Asia (Sydney, Singapore, Hong Kong and Shanghai).</p>
<p>Founded in 2004, with offices in New York &amp; Toronto, RDF is an innovator in the field of financial data management, including data architecture, reference data, data models and security master software. RDF’s principals were the driving force behind the development of the highly successful “GoldenSource” product. In 2003 the principals left to establish RDF, providing a new and innovative approach to financial data management &#8211; “multiple versions of the truth”. RDF’s software suite has been adopted by leading global financial institutions, such as Fitch Ratings. It is the most complete and configurable data models in the industry, together with a powerful distribution / integration / enrichment layer based on service-oriented architecture.</p>
<p>The acquisition by First Derivatives of RDF broadens the range of Delta products on offer by introducing best-in-class products in for example reference data solutions. It also enables the Company to leverage this subject matter expertise into its consulting service offering.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>SIX Telekurs and ReferenceDataFactory LLC (RDF) have today announced the availability of RDF Adaptive Client Technology for the Valordata Feed. In keeping with its mission to provide out-of-the-box reference data integration solutions, ReferenceDataFactory has added full support for Valordata Feed (VDF), SIX Telekurs’ flagship securities reference data service.</p>
<p>The Valordata Feed from SIX Telekurs is a complete back office solution, providing comprehensive security master reference data, corporate actions and valuation pricing for over 5 million global securities. VDF, which was designed from the start to facilitate straight-through processing, delivers even the most complex data in a simple coded manner to eliminate ambiguities and to speed processing. Specifically, the sophisticated data structure of VDF seamlessly links all data elements associated with a security, from terms and conditions, to prices, to markets, to current and historical corporate actions and events.</p>
<p>&#8220;By preserving the data linkages inherent in VDF, we’ve ensured that customers retain the full benefit of the structure and encoding unique to SIX Telekurs data service&#8221;, said Gerry Marsh, Managing Director of RDF. &#8220;These data linkages are critical for the holistic view which is crucial to an effective data management processing chain. VDF in RDF will add tremendous integration value for customers.&#8221;</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><span style="font-size: x-small;">ReferenceDataFactory LLC (RDF) today announces the              availability the RDF Integration Data Model. The model exposes security              and market data in a comprehensive business centric representation.              The model comes after three years of development and on the back of              decades of direct experience integrating security and market data              globally. Says Garry Wright, Managing Director and CIO at RDF, &#8220;The              data model provides a standard business view of data across all asset              types. This representation is meant to avoid the challenges of mining              and integrating data delivered through operational and highly normalized              models. In addition, the demormalized nature of the representation              allows us to support immediate transformation to other dialects such              as MDDL or FpML&#8221;. Wright goes on to say “while the push              toward adaptive service oriented solutions is inevitable, the success              of these solutions will be defined by the business knowledge contained              in the services.&#8221;</span></p>
<p><span style="font-size: x-small;">In keeping with their adaptive approach, the RDF Integration              Data Model is completely extendable, and can expose data through XML              via messaging or web services or through a relational database implementation.              In addition to providing advanced service orchestration capabilities,              the RDF adaptive implementation provides an extendable base of expert              business knowledge exposed through predefined services.</span></p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Reference Data Factory LLC (RDF) today announces the              availability of RDF Adaptive Client Technology for Bloomberg Back              Office. The lightweight SOA based solution is designed to provide              out-of-the-box integration across Bloomberg Back Office and Per Security              data offerings. The Adaptive Client runs in virtually any operating              and database environment and exposes Bloomberg provided data through              format standards such as XML and technology standards such as Java              Messaging, Web Services and denormalized databases.</p>
